Types of Ice and Their Uses

True ice machines are available in different configurations to suit various service needs.

Cube Ice
Best for iced tea, cold brew, soft drinks, and spirits. It melts slowly and keeps drinks cold longer.

Nugget Ice
Soft and chewable, ideal for cafés, cocktail bars, and specialty beverage outlets.

Flake Ice
Commonly used for seafood displays, salad bars, and chilled food presentation.

Choosing the right ice type improves both presentation and customer experience.

How to Choose the Right True Ice Machine

Before selecting a model, consider these factors:

Daily Ice Usage
Estimate how much ice you use during peak periods.

Available Space
Ensure enough room for installation and ventilation.

Ice Type Required
Match the ice style to your menu and service needs.

Storage Capacity
Choose adequate bin size for busy operations.

Water Quality
Filtered water improves ice clarity and machine performance.


Maintenance Tips for Long-Term Performance

To keep your True ice machine running smoothly:

  • Clean and sanitize regularly

  • Remove mineral buildup on schedule

  • Maintain proper airflow

  • Check filters periodically

  • Train staff on correct handling

Good maintenance ensures better ice quality and fewer breakdowns.
